Flonase is not a decongestant; it is a nasal corticosteroid spray that helps reduce inflammation in the nasal passages. It is used to treat symptoms of allergic rhinitis, such as nasal congestion, runny nose, and sneezing. While it can alleviate nasal congestion, it does so by addressing the underlying inflammation rather than directly constricting blood vessels like traditional decongestants do.
